Rob Hunter left this review about The Postal Order (JD Wetherspoon)

Visited back in March. At the time of my visit the cask ale offering consisted of the Trio, Jaipur, plus five guests. Guest ales priced at £2.64 a pint.

A fairly standard Spoons, in an externally grand looking building but as noted by Quinno in the previous review, nothing to get too excited about on the inside.

There are some booths to the front section under the windows opposite the bar. To the left and right are raised areas with additional seating. To the rear left is another seating area, more popular with families dining, and this section leads to the stairs that will take you up to the toilets. There is some external seating to the front and to the left of the pub.

It's expectedly busy, it's a Spoons, and it certainly does a job in Blackburn where it's slim pickings for real ale.

Quinno _ left this review about The Postal Order (JD Wetherspoon)

A very striking building but little of the period stylings survive inside, a long front-facer with stark lighting and a battery hen cage layout. Attractive jumbo arched windows but the décor in general felt a bit dowdy. My Three B’s Doff Cocker cask was somewhat long pour (NBSS 2.5). The unexplained postbox with dog and bone was a diverting feature – I presume it’s a link to the building’s previous use as a GPO. In most towns this one wouldn’t merit much attention but in Blackburn it’s a default. 5.5

Old Boots left this review about The Postal Order (JD Wetherspoon)

A long thin spoons in a splendid deco building, a long long counter runs down the back wall, booth seating all down the opposite front wall and low tables in a row down the middle with a row of high ones between there and the counter, it has a raised area at one end and a cluster of machines at the other. An odd pump layout of 6+6 with three more in the middle serving the unholy trinity, the outer groups have the three plus a better choice, Wilde Child from the light side (Leeds) for me today, which was ok. Usual T-bars and solos in between the pulls. Geometric carpet for ‘spoons carpet collectors, tartan upholstery in the booths. A couple of secluded areas at one end, the toilets are upstairs of course. A serviceable spoons especially in a beer desert like Blackburn.
